Chinroyen-Droog, Sir Alexander Allan, 1st Baronet, 1794
This uncoloured aquatint is taken from plate 8 of captain alexander allan's 'views in the mysore country'. A hill-fort, channarayanadurga is in the tumkur district of karnataka and is one of the nava-durgas ('nine-forts') around bangalore. Small but strong, it surrendered to troops commanded by lieutenant colonel maxwell, 23 july 1791. Control was officially ceded to the british by the treaty of seringapatam at the conclusion of the war in 1792. Item number: 3788. Object Type: print. Date: 1794. Place of creation: London.
